A clothing and custom-apparel manufacturer selling to wholesale buyers and direct consumers — two audiences that usually force brands into two storefronts. Manizh built a single Shopify storefront that serves both: one catalog of custom garments and specialty finishes with full variant options, Stripe integrated for secure end-to-end checkout, and order-to-fulfillment configured natively in Shopify.
Custom team sportswear is sold through back-and-forth quoting — sketches, emails, revisions — which caps how many teams a brand can serve. Manizh built a bespoke storefront centered on a live 3D kit builder — design, color, collar, fabric — with CRM integration, WhatsApp commerce, and Shopify Flow automations running order and customer processes end to end.
